Lightning, Ozone, & Rain

Published by trdassociates under General

My twelve year old son returned from school to tell me
how lightning is a source of nourishment for the earth
as it contributes to the creation of ozone that is delivered
to the earth on the droplets of rain, thus the inspiration of this poem.

“Like Lightning”

Scatter light fell like
Seeds through black clouds,
Impossible to chart
We shuddered at its shock.

Thunderous rain pounded,
Drowning out all thought,
A mantra to command
Attention of those distracted.

Next day we assessed
The damage – ripped shingles,
Torn siding, flooding as
Birds chirped in thanksgiving.

Following the storm,
Clattering lightening,
Fear as foundations shuddered,
There is nourishment still – in silence.

“I saw Satan fall like
Lightning from Heaven.”
Luke 10:18
